Bilateral Middle Cerebellar Peduncle Sign in a Patient with Cerebral Autosomal Dominant Arteriopathy with Subcortical Infarcts and Leukoencephalopathy and Coronavirus Disease 2019.

A 59-year-old man without risk factors for atherosclerosis was diagnosed with coronavirus disease 2019 (COVID-19). Four days later, he developed dysarthria and gait disturbance. Neurological examination revealed slurred speech, ataxia, and mild cognitive decline. Brain magnetic resonance imaging revealed multiple infarcts in the bilateral middle cerebellar peduncles and leukoencephalopathy, indicating the diagnosis of cerebral autosomal dominant arteriopathy with subcortical infarcts and leukoencephalopathy (CADASIL). Genetic testing confirmed a pathogenic NOTCH3 variant (c. 505C>T, p. Arg169Cys) (NM_000435. 3). A skin biopsy supported the diagnosis. He was treated with cilostazol and after three months of rehabilitation, he regained an independent walking ability. COVID-19 increases the risk of ischemic stroke in CADASIL patients, with bilateral middle cerebellar peduncle infarctions being notable in the present case.
